    Originally posted by fhhuber View Post
    Well... there are failures that will take down the UBEC with the ESC at the same time. I had a flawed solder joint (factory) on the LiPo's connector one time. It heated up under load and melted the solder, disconnecting the LiPo from the connector. Fortunately on that plane I used a separate LiFe pack to power the RX. (which has its own ways it can fail)

    There's no solution that is 100% guaranteed.
    Nothing is 100%.... but you can get really high percentages by doing things right!
